首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

基于Apache Pig拉丁语中的键或值的过滤器映射

是指在Apache Pig中使用键值对进行数据过滤和映射的操作。

Apache Pig是一个用于大规模数据分析的平台,它提供了一种高级的脚本语言Pig Latin来处理和分析数据。在Pig Latin中,可以使用键值对来表示数据,并通过过滤器和映射操作来对数据进行处理。

过滤器操作是基于键或值对数据进行筛选的过程。可以使用逻辑运算符(如等于、不等于、大于、小于等)来定义过滤条件,从而过滤出符合条件的数据。

映射操作是将键或值对数据转换为新的键或值对的过程。可以使用函数和表达式来对数据进行计算和转换,生成新的键或值对。

基于Apache Pig拉丁语中的键或值的过滤器映射具有以下优势:

  1. 灵活性:可以根据具体需求定义不同的过滤条件和映射规则,灵活适应不同的数据处理需求。
  2. 高效性:Apache Pig提供了优化的执行引擎,可以高效地处理大规模数据集。
  3. 可扩展性:可以通过编写自定义函数和表达式来扩展过滤器和映射的功能,满足更复杂的数据处理需求。

基于Apache Pig拉丁语中的键或值的过滤器映射在以下场景中有广泛的应用:

  1. 数据清洗:可以通过过滤器操作过滤掉无效或异常的数据,保证数据的质量。
  2. 数据转换:可以通过映射操作对数据进行计算和转换,生成新的数据集。
  3. 数据分析:可以根据特定的过滤条件和映射规则,对数据进行统计和分析。

腾讯云提供了一系列与大数据处理相关的产品,例如:

  1. 腾讯云数据仓库(Tencent Cloud Data Warehouse):提供高性能、弹性扩展的数据仓库服务,支持基于Apache Pig的数据处理和分析。
  2. 腾讯云大数据计算服务(Tencent Cloud Big Data Computing Service):提供基于Apache Pig的大数据计算服务,支持快速、高效地处理大规模数据集。
  3. 腾讯云数据集成服务(Tencent Cloud Data Integration Service):提供数据集成和转换服务,支持将不同数据源的数据进行整合和转换。

更多关于腾讯云相关产品的介绍和详细信息,可以访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券